How to think about r/auspol

The community focuses on Australian politics, providing a platform for open discussions on political issues, policies, and events. It serves as a hub for political enthusiasts to share insights, opinions, and news related to the Australian political landscape. Members often engage in debates and analysis, making it distinct for its serious yet passionate discourse.

Confidence 4/5

  • Audience

    Participants in this community are typically politically engaged Australians, ranging from students to professionals, who are interested in current affairs and policy discussions. The vibe is generally analytical and critical, with members caring deeply about transparency, accountability, and social justice in politics.

  • Posting culture

    Content that thrives includes well-researched articles, thoughtful commentary, and relevant news updates. Members appreciate nuanced discussions and often downvote posts that lack substance or are overly partisan without evidence. Posting frequency can vary, but active discussions tend to peak around significant political events or announcements.
